DRIVING MISS DAISY

.

Director and Producer: Susan Metz Foster       December 1-16, 2000

.

This well-loved play tells the story of an aging, crotchety white Southern lady, and a proud, soft-spoken black man hired to be her chauffeur. In a series of absorbing scenes spanning 25 years, the two, despite their mutual differences, grow ever closer to, and more dependent upon each other eventually becoming lifelong friends. "Driving Miss Daisy" is a poignant and moving chronicle of how our differences can become our strengths.

This touching tale featured Bettsy Gauerke as Miss Daisy, Rod Hasseman as Boolie and Gordon Graham as Hoke.
